Ingredients
-1 10oz can of cream of potato soup (Campbell's is vegetarian, some others have meat stock in them!)
-1 15oz can of mixed vegetables
-1/2 cup milk
-2 9in frozen prepared pie crusts (the kind you roll out!)
-A pinch of salt, pepper, thyme, and basil
Instructions
-Pre-heat oven to 375*F (190*C)
-Roll out first pie crust into a 9in dish (I usually use glass but it doesn't really matter)
-Place pie crust in oven for roughly 5mins (while you prepare the filling), this keeps the bottom from getting soggy
-Mix potato soup, mixed vegetables, milk in a medium bowl, add seasonings to taste (usually just a tsp each, though I go a bit heavier on the basil)
-Take pie crust out of the oven, it should be a bit bubbly on the bottom, and pour mixture in
-Roll out the second pie crust on top and pinch edges closed with a fork, cut off excess crust and cut at least 2 2in slits in the top of the pie (I usually draw a little heart with the knife)
-Let cook 40mins till golden brown
